> I've been seeing random issues with Net-SNMP (v5.4.2.1) running on
> "Windows 6.1" (as reported by a Microsoft agent).
>
> Every once in a while, when walking the tree (snmpwalk), I see it stop
> with problems on ifIndex. (BTW. it happened on other columns in the
> ifTable when I explicitly walked those columns too.)
>
> .1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.1.17 = INTEGER: 17
> .1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.1.18 = INTEGER: 18
> .1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.1.18 = INTEGER: 5
> Error: OID not increasing: .1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.1.18
>  >= .1.3.6.1.2.1.2.2.1.1.18
>
> Restarting Net-SNMP resolves the issue until some time in the future...
> it happens again.  Once 'in the mode', it seems that only a restart
> will get it out of it.  Also, I cannot re-create the problem on-demand.
>
> I know this is a 3+ year old version, but that's what they are running
> primarily because there are no pre-built Windows binaries available of
> anything more 'current'.
>
> Was this a known problem?
>

Which command line options have been configured for the Net-SNMP service
(via register.bat) ?
